Abstract:The microlens array anti-counterfeiting film technology is a new anti-counterfeiting technology, which is easy to observe and easy to identify, especially in the environment of insufficient light. A high sensitivity positive photoresist AZ 1500, a high-resolution positive photoresist AZ MIR-703 and a negative SU-8 photoresist were used to produce a microlens array anti-counterfeiting film. Photoresist melting was used to fabricate the microlens array, PDMS was used to fabricate the reverse mold of the microlens array, SU-8 and PDMS reverse mold were used together to make the final microlens array, and the photoresist AZ 1500 was used to fabricate the microtext array. Subsequently, a kind of microlens array anti-counterfeiting film with a stereoscopic effect was obtained. The experimental characterization and analysis show that the microlens array anti-counterfeiting film prepared by the method has obvious effect and good uniformity. Compared with other methods, the method has the advantages of simple process, low requirement for material and equipment, stable process parameter and easy control. It is a simple and novel method.
